We are committed to delivering high-quality, person-centered care in a supportive environment. As a member of our team, Unit Clerks support the administrative functioning of the units. They work closely with the charge nurses and collaborate with the interdisciplinary and nursing teams to optimize care for the residents in our facility. The Unit Clerk performs clerical, receptionist and administrative duties associated with the activities and requirements of the unit or program. This includes, but limited to, processing physician orders, processing admissions and discharges, booking appointments, communicating with patients and families, stocks forms, photocopies, and faxes. Unit Clerks require excellent organizational, interpersonal, communication and computer skills, and will be able to effectively work with other disciplines, departments, patients and families. Required Qualifications: Must have a Certificate from a recognized training program which includes a practicum component. A course in Medical Terminology is required. An equ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
Additional Required Qualifications:Unit Clerk/Medical Office Assistant Certification. Excellent typing and computer skills. Excellent spoken and written communication skills. Ability to adapt within a fast-paced environment.
Preferred Qualifications:Unit Clerk Certification preferred. Recent Continuing Care experience. Experience using ESP, Connect Care and Microsoft Office.
